Protocolo de rede

Um protocolo de rede é um conjunto de regras e convenções que regem a forma como os dados são trocados entre dispositivos em uma rede de computadores. Os protocolos definem o formato dos pacotes de dados, o método de endereçamento, as regras para detecção e correção de erros e os procedimentos para iniciar e encerrar sessões de comunicação.

Aspectos-chave dos protocolos de rede:

  1. Formato do pacote de dados: os protocolos definem a estrutura dos pacotes de dados, incluindo o cabeçalho, que contém informações como os endereços de origem e destino, e a carga útil, que contém os dados reais que estão sendo transmitidos.
  2. Endereçamento: os protocolos definem como os dispositivos em uma rede são identificados e endereçados, como o uso de endereços IP no caso do Protocolo de Internet (IP).
  3. Roteamento: os protocolos definem como os Conjuntos de dados são roteados entre os dispositivos em uma rede, incluindo a determinação do melhor caminho para um pacote chegar ao seu destino.
  4. Detecção e correção de erros: os protocolos incluem mecanismos para detectar e corrigir erros que podem ocorrer durante a transmissão de dados, como somas de verificação e retransmissão de pacotes perdidos.
  5. Controle de fluxo: os protocolos incluem mecanismos para gerenciar o fluxo de dados entre dispositivos para evitar congestionamento e garantir o uso eficiente dos recursos da rede.
  6. Estabelecimento e encerramento de conexão: os protocolos definem os procedimentos para estabelecer e encerrar sessões de comunicação entre dispositivos, como o handshake de três vias usado no Protocolo de Controle de Transmissão (TCP).
  7. Segurança: os protocolos incluem recursos para garantir a segurança dos dados transmitidos por uma rede, como criptografia, autenticação e controle de acesso.

Tipos de protocolos de rede:

  1. Conjunto de protocolos da Internet (TCP/IP): Conjunto de protocolos usados para comunicação pela Internet, incluindo IP, TCP, UDP e outros.
  2. Ethernet: um protocolo usado para comunicação em redes locais (LANs) usando conexões com fio.
  3. Wi-Fi (IEEE 802.11): Protocolo utilizado para comunicação sem fio em redes locais (LANs) e redes de longa distância (WANs).
  4. HTTP (Protocolo de Transferência de Hipertexto): Um protocolo usado para transmitir documentos de hipertexto na World Wide Web.
  5. SMTP (Protocolo Simples de Transferência de Correio): Um protocolo utilizado para enviar mensagens de e-mail entre servidores.
  6. DNS (Domain Name System): Um protocolo usado para traduzir nomes de domínio em endereços IP.
  7. FTP (Protocolo de Transferência de Arquivos): Um protocolo usado para transferir arquivos entre um cliente e um servidor.

Importância dos protocolos de rede:

  1. Interoperabilidade: os protocolos permitem que dispositivos e sistemas de diferentes fabricantes se comuniquem entre si através de uma rede, garantindo compatibilidade e interoperabilidade.
  2. Eficiência: os protocolos definem métodos eficientes para transmissão de dados, roteamento e tratamento de erros, garantindo que os recursos de rede sejam usados de forma eficaz.
  3. Confiabilidade: os protocolos incluem mecanismos para detecção e correção de erros, garantindo que os dados sejam transmitidos de forma confiável, mesmo na presença de erros.
  4. Segurança: os protocolos incluem recursos para garantir a segurança e a privacidade dos dados transmitidos por uma rede, como criptografia e autenticação.

Em resumo, os protocolos de rede são essenciais para permitir a comunicação entre dispositivos em redes de computadores. Eles definem as regras e convenções que regem a forma como os dados são transmitidos, garantindo a interoperabilidade, eficiência, confiabilidade e segurança na comunicação em rede e na extração de dados.

CONFIADO POR 20,000+ CLIENTES EM TODO O MUNDO

Pronto para começar?